How Much Does the Least Expensive Parrot? Prices & Species Guide
Thinking about acquiring a feathered pet into your home? The upfront cost of a parrot can vary significantly, and many ask what the lowest price point looks like. While exotic parrot breeds attract hefty sums, there are some more economical options. Generally, the cheapest parrots available tend to be conures and certain cockatiel varieties, with costs often starting from $100 to $300. However, be aware that rehoming fees or breeder expenses can influence the overall cost. Keep in mind that the future costs, such as food, toys, and avian care, are also important to think about. In the end, responsible parrot ownership requires a significant commitment of both effort and capital. Affordable Parrot Types in the USA: The Budget Companion Directory
Dreaming of welcoming a parrot but worried about a hefty price tag? You're not alone! While some parrot varieties can easily set you back a lot of dollars, there are actually several quite affordable options available to US bird enthusiasts. Generally, smaller parrots tend to be significantly less expensive than their larger, highly prestigious counterparts. For example, consider the Budgerigar, or "Parakeet," which is consistently within the most available parrots at the market. Other contenders for the title of "cheapest parrot" include various conure species, like the Green-Cheeked Conure and the Sun Conure, though it is crucial to remember that even budget-friendly parrots require a long-term commitment of time, money, and care. Ultimately, researching a specific parrot's needs and potential lifespan before making a decision is essential regardless of price.

United States Bird Prices: Locating the Best Offers on Plumed Companions
Acquiring a parrot can be a joyful experience, but understanding USA avian prices is crucial for responsible custody. Typically, the value of a bird varies considerably depending on its species, maturity, condition, and standing of the breeder. You might find smaller bird types for roughly $300, while more significant parrot species like cockatoos can readily amount to $1000 or more. Resourceful purchasers often investigate digital marketplaces, speak with regional avian suppliers, and examine shelter alternatives to get the best price on their upcoming feathered friend.
